  • What Makes a Remote IoT Platform the Best for Raspberry Pi?

    When evaluating remote IoT platforms for Raspberry Pi, several factors come into play. The best platforms are those that offer seamless integration, ease of use, and robust features. Raspberry Pi users often look for platforms that provide real-time data monitoring, remote access, and automation capabilities. Additionally, the platform should support multiple communication protocols, such as MQTT, HTTP, and WebSocket, to ensure compatibility with various devices.

    Another critical factor is scalability. The best remote IoT platform for Raspberry Pi should be able to grow with your project. Whether you’re managing a single device or a network of hundreds, the platform should handle the load without compromising performance. Furthermore, a user-friendly interface is essential, especially for beginners who may not have extensive technical knowledge.

    Lastly, community support and documentation play a significant role in determining the quality of a platform. A strong community ensures that you can find solutions to common problems and access tutorials to enhance your understanding. Platforms like Blynk, ThingsBoard, and Adafruit IO are popular choices among Raspberry Pi users due to their comprehensive documentation and active communities.

    Is There a Free Remote IoT Platform for Raspberry Pi Users?

    Yes, there are several free remote IoT platforms available for Raspberry Pi users. These platforms provide essential features without requiring any financial investment, making them ideal for hobbyists and students. Platforms like Blynk and ThingsBoard offer free tiers that include device management, data visualization, and basic automation tools.

    However, it’s important to note that free platforms often come with limitations. For instance, the number of devices or data points you can manage may be restricted. Additionally, advanced features like custom dashboards or enhanced security may require a paid subscription. Despite these limitations, free platforms are an excellent starting point for experimenting with IoT projects on your Raspberry Pi.

    Why Is Security Important in a RemoteIoT Platform Free Raspberry Pi?

    Security is a critical consideration when choosing a remote IoT platform for your Raspberry Pi. IoT devices are often vulnerable to cyberattacks, and a compromised platform can lead to data breaches or device malfunctions. Free platforms may not always offer the same level of security as paid options, so it’s essential to evaluate their security features carefully.

    Look for platforms that use encryption, two-factor authentication, and secure communication protocols. These features ensure that your data remains protected and your devices are safe from unauthorized access. Additionally, platforms with regular security updates and active community support are more likely to address vulnerabilities promptly.

    Common Challenges When Using a RemoteIoT Platform Free Raspberry Pi

    While free remote IoT platforms offer many benefits, they also come with challenges. One common issue is limited functionality. Free tiers often restrict the number of devices or data points you can manage, which can be frustrating for larger projects. Additionally, customer support may be limited or unavailable, leaving you to rely on community forums for assistance.

    Another challenge is performance. Free platforms may not offer the same level of reliability or speed as paid options, leading to potential delays or downtime. To overcome these challenges, carefully evaluate the platform’s limitations and consider upgrading to a paid plan if necessary.

    What Are the Best Alternatives to Free Remote IoT Platforms?

    If you’re looking for alternatives to free remote IoT platforms, consider paid options like AWS IoT, Microsoft Azure IoT, or Google Cloud IoT. These platforms offer advanced features, robust security, and reliable performance, making them ideal for large-scale or commercial projects. While they come with a cost, their benefits often outweigh the investment.

    Another alternative is building your own IoT platform using open-source tools. This approach gives you complete control over your platform’s features and security. However, it requires technical expertise and time to set up and maintain.
